This company just completed a huge project in my block - they replaced and concreted 12 houses’ portion of our community drive; plus 4 personal driveways, 7 dry wells and one sidewalk. They worked very hard, the price was excellent, the workmanship was very good - with 2 criticisms - I think there should have been more expansion [isolation] joints - they finished pouring the concrete for the day, which was not always at the property line, and then poured the next slab the next or following day - somedays this meant there were 48’ lengths or so, without a break. They also should be carrying sakrete with them in case the job runs “short.” Mine did run short and they were trying to use the “discharge” from cleaning the mixer truck to finish it; fortunately, I had some unused sakrete in my garage, which they used.. They had printed contracts, they accepted personal checks, they asked for them to be made out to their company name; so I love that they were not trying to launder the $$ under the table. My other problem was their lack of communication between giving us the bid and starting the work; it was 2 weeks or so and the younger man did not keep appointments to sign the contract/take the deposits. We figured they were not going to do the work and we were all ready to start getting more estimates and start all over when all of a sudden, we got a call that they were going to start the next day. It would have taken just one call to my neighbor, who made all the contacts, to keep us all in the loop, but they did not do that. They almost lost our job and we would have missed out on good workmanship at a very competitive price.
